B-28 DGC-2020 Modbus Communication 9400200990 Rev I
Holding
Register
Parameter Range
Read/Write
Supported
Data
Format
Units
44356
3 Phase Overvoltage Alarm
Configuration (59-2)
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
44358 1 Phase Overvoltage Pickup (59-2) 70-576 R W Volts in increments of 1
44360
1 Phase Overvoltage Activation
Delay (59-2)
0-300 R W (Seconds / 10) in increments of 1
44362
1 Phase Overvoltage Alarm
Configuration (59-2)
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
44364
Overcurrent Low Line Scale Factor
(51-2)
0.000 - 3.000 R W FP
In increments of
0.001
44366
Overvoltage Low Line Scale Factor
(59-2)
0.000 - 3.000 R W FP
In increments of
0.001
44368
Undervoltage Low Line Scale
Factor (27-2)
0.000 - 3.000 R W FP
In increments of
0.001
44370 Phase Imbalance Hysteresis 1-5 R W Volts in increments of 1
44372
3 Phase Undervoltage Hysteresis
(27-1)
1-60 R W Volts in increments of 1
44374
1 Phase Undervoltage Hysteresis
(27-1)
1-60 R W Volts in increments of 1
44376
3 Phase Overvoltage Hysteresis
(59-1)
1-60 R W Volts in increments of 1
44378
1 Phase Overvoltage Hysteresis
(59-1)
1-60 R W Volts in increments of 1
44380 Underfrequency Hysteresis 1-400 R W Deci-hertz in increments of 1
44382 Overfrequency Hysteresis 1-400 R W Deci-hertz in increments of 1
44384
3 Phase Undervoltage Hysteresis
(27-2)
1-60 R W Volts in increments of 1
44386
1 Phase Undervoltage Hysteresis
(27-2)
1-60 R W Volts in increments of 1
44388
3 Phase Overvoltage Hysteresis
(59-2)
1-60 R W Volts in increments of 1
44390
1 Phase Overvoltage Hysteresis
(59-2)
1-60 R W Volts in increments of 1
44392 3 Phase Reverse Power Pickup -500 to 50 R W Deci-percent in increments of 1
44394
3 Phase Reverse Power Activation
Delay
0-300 R W Deci-second in increments of 1
44396
3 Phase Reverse Power Alarm
Configuration
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
44398 3 Phase Reverse Power Hysteresis 10-100 R W Deci-percent in increments of 1
44400 1 Phase Reverse Power Pickup -500 to 50 R W Deci-percent in increments of 1
44402
1 Phase Reverse Power Activation
Delay
0-300 R W Deci-second in increments of 1
44404
1 Phase Reverse Power Alarm
Configuration
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
44406 1 Phase Reverse Power Hysteresis 10-100 R W Deci-percent in increments of 1
44408 3 Phase Loss of Excitation Pickup -1500 to 0 R W Deci-percent in increments of 1
44410
3 Phase Loss of Excitation
Activation Delay
0-300 R W Deci-second in increments of 1
44412
3 Phase Loss of Excitation Alarm
Configuration
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
44414
3 Phase Loss of Excitation
Hysteresis
10-100 R W Deci-percent in increments of 1
44416 1 Phase Loss of Excitation Pickup -1500 to 0 R W Deci-percent in increments of 1
44418
1 Phase Loss of Excitation
Activation Delay
0-300 R W Deci-second in increments of 1
44420
1 Phase Loss of Excitation Alarm
Configuration
0-2 R W
0 = None
1 = Alarm
2 = Pre-Alarm
